Excerpt from Property Consecrated, or Honoring God With Our Substance: An Inquiry Into the Will of God in Relation to Property, and an Examination of the Temporal and Spiritual Advantage Arising From Its Right Use Bonpring God. To this the good man is solemnly devoted. He often regrets that he does not better succeed in accomplishn it. He asks with deep concern, How shall I honor God i Especially, How shall I honor him with my earthly possessions? These are too often a snare to him. He finds himself unduly attached to them. His con. Science not unfrequently rebukes him for the reluctance he feels in parting with them, even for the noblest purposes of Christian benevolence. He mourns over this weak ness, if not evidence of remaining deprav ity. He would desire, we assume, to be relieved from these embarrassments - to learn how he can make all his worldly employments subserve his Spiritual inter ests - how he can become happy in giv ing all due support to the claims of God how he may, so far as his responsibility ex tends, remove all temporal embarrassments from the Church, and secure the greatest possible efficiency for all her enterprises. Let him read this little book. It will con duct him to God's own method of solving allthese problems, and at the same time se cure the richest returns of true satisfaction, business prosperity, and spiritual enlarge ment.
